				<title>The Practical Benefits of Structuring a Separation Outside the Courtroom

Choosing to dissolve a marriage through traditional litigation is often like taking a sledgehammer to a delicate piece of glass; it gets the job done, but it leaves behind an absolute mess of expenses and broken relationships. Fortunately, the courtroom is not the only option for couples seeking an exit strategy. Choosing a structured, neutral negotiation process allows individuals to dismantle their marital contract with their finances, privacy, and sanity intact. This alternative approach gives couples total control over the terms of their separation, replacing an adversarial judge with a neutral professional focused entirely on finding practical compromises.

The financial contrast between litigation and neutral negotiation is staggering. Traditional court battles drain resources through multiple filing fees, deposition costs, and competing attorney retainers that accumulate with every motion filed. Mediation compresses this process into a structured series of focused sessions where both parties work together to review assets, divide debts, and outline parenting plans. By cutting out the procedural delays of the court system, couples can finalize their agreements at a fraction of the cost, preserving their hard-earned wealth for their separate futures rather than spending it on a long legal battle.

Privacy is another significant advantage that couples regain when they step outside the public courtroom. Every document filed in a traditional divorce becomes a matter of public record, meaning financial statements, business valuations, and personal allegations are accessible to anyone who cares to look. Mediation sessions occur behind closed doors, and the detailed discussions remain completely confidential. The only document that enters the public record is the final settlement agreement, allowing couples to handle sensitive family transitions with the dignity and privacy they deserve.

For parents, the collaborative nature of mediation establishes a much healthier foundation for future co-parenting than a bitter court trial ever could. When a judge dictates custody schedules, both sides often leave the courtroom feeling misunderstood or slighted, which can fuel years of continued resentment and future modification battles. Mediation encourages parents to design a customized parenting plan that fits their specific work schedules, holiday traditions, and child-rearing philosophies. Working together to solve these early challenges helps parents build the communication habits needed to manage future school events, graduations, and family milestones successfully.

The timeline of a mediated separation is dictated entirely by the participants, rather than an overburdened court calendar. Litigation can drag on for eighteen months or longer as parties wait for available hearing dates and endure endless continuances. A mediated agreement can often be drafted and finalized within a few months, depending entirely on the willingness of both parties to provide honest financial disclosures and negotiate in good faith. This accelerated timeline allows both individuals to find closure quickly and begin rebuilding their separate lives without a long legal dispute hanging over them.
